Frequently Asked Questions

What is the population and demographic makeup of Chenango County?

The total population of Chenango County is approximately 46,321. The largest age group is 35-64 year olds. This demographic data is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au.

Is Chenango County walkable and transit-friendly?

Based on local geographic data, Chenango County has an amenity and walkability score of 52/100 and a transit score of 40/100. This indicates moderate access to local amenities and transportation.

Do more people rent or own homes in Chenango County?

The housing market in Chenango County is predominantly driven by homeowners, with 75% of housing units being owner-occupied and 25% being renter-occupied.
